For the weekly sync: we've confirmed that the batch image-resizing CLI behaves differently on agents four and seven. Output dimensions and JPEG quality diverge from what the pipeline spec declares, and the discrepancy traces to agents carrying locally edited config files that were never reconciled after the March toolchain upgrade. Resizes from those agents fail the checksum gate intermittently, blocking two release candidates. The canonical settings every agent should carry are listed below.

deployment values, faduf-tawep:
SORDOR_LOG_LEVEL=error
SORDOR_METRICS_HOST=metrics.sordor.nelvrolabs.internal
SORDOR_POOL_SIZE=4

TURN-208: Gatevale turnstile counters at the Merrow Field pilot double-count when a rotation reverses mid-cycle. Attendance totals drift roughly 2% high per event. The debounce window fix is implemented, reviewed by Ilsa, and soak-tested across two simulated match days without drift. Ready for your cut; the candidate build is identified below.

trace token, tagag-tafog: htk6_5ed18c

## Sensor drift: what to do at 3am

If the GrowLoop controller starts reporting humidity swings that don't match the backup probes in the Fernwick greenhouse, it's almost always sensor drift, not an actual climate event. Don't panic and don't touch the vents manually. First, restart the calibration daemon and give it ten minutes to re-baseline. If readings still disagree by more than 5%, flip the controller into safe mode. The safe-mode thresholds it will use are these.

config for yahap-bajof:
[istix]
host = istix.qorvelsys.internal
user = istix_svc
database = istix_prod

## Build Migration

Welcome to team Oxhollow. We're mid-migration from the legacy Makefile setup to Hermet, our hermetic build system. Rules: no network access in build steps, all toolchains pinned, outputs must be byte-reproducible. Old targets live under //legacy and are frozen. New code goes in //core with Hermet rules only. Run the verifier before pushing; CI rejects non-hermetic actions. All release artifacts are signed with the key below.

rollout seal: bky4_x7Gc